What happened

Uber, much like the cities it serves, is constantly growing and changing, which means its network traffic must be carefully managed to avoid congestion. The company has evolved its technical strategies over time to keep application traffic flowing smoothly across its platform.

A key part of that effort is application awareness on Cloud Interconnect, an industry-first tool for prioritizing application traffic across hybrid networks. Uber helped design the tool as an early partner, and it uses DSCP marking and configured queuing profiles to classify and prioritize critical end-user traffic over less time-sensitive data.

The tool offers four major features: traffic handling, congestion response, latency management, and cost efficiency. Traffic is sorted into six distinct classes, and business-critical data is protected through strict priority or bandwidth sharing policies. Uber began deploying it during a private preview, starting with Google Cloud Interconnect locations in Phoenix, Arizona, and Ashburn, Virginia.

Why it matters

For global-scale organizations like Uber, migrating distributed and hybrid applications is risky if it interrupts service. Application awareness lets Uber move massive amounts of data, including large analytics workloads and emerging AI use cases, without congesting the network or degrading business-critical application performance.

Legacy overprovisioning approaches treat all traffic equally and can drop high-priority data during bursts, making them costly and unreliable at Uber's scale. Application awareness offers predictable low latency and protects critical traffic, giving Uber the confidence to proceed with a Google Cloud migration while reducing the risk of service interruptions.
